Javascript MutationObserver已激发多次(但仅当item.length==1项时才正常)

Javascript MutationObserver已激发多次(但仅当item.length==1项时才正常),javascript,mutation-observers,Javascript,Mutation Observers,我观察到一个div容器带有新的MutationObserver(childlist) 如果我(通过javascript onclick)从容器中删除一个元素,观测者只会被触发一次——没关系, 但是 如果我删除了多个项目(通过javascript onclick),那么观察者会为我删除的每个项目激发 我不知道有多少项目将被删除 有没有人知道我该如何预防这种情况,或者之前对突变进行分组 背景是: 在每次更改之后,我都会发出一个Ajax请求,以过滤项目——如果观察者多次触发,那么每次都会触发一个Aja

我观察到一个div容器带有
新的MutationObserver
(childlist)

如果我(通过javascript onclick)从容器中删除一个元素,观测者只会被触发一次——没关系, 但是
如果我删除了多个项目(通过javascript onclick),那么观察者会为我删除的每个项目激发

我不知道有多少项目将被删除

有没有人知道我该如何预防这种情况,或者之前对突变进行分组

背景是: 在每次更改之后,我都会发出一个Ajax请求,以过滤项目——如果观察者多次触发,那么每次都会触发一个Ajax请求。。。(在4ms内执行4次)

抱歉,我没有示例代码,但有一个在线直播站点-> 查找
fetch
(请忽略TypeError:-)


很抱歉,标题不好,但我没有更好的主意…

只需对代码进行去模糊处理。非常简单-完美,谢谢!只需去除代码的痕迹。非常简单-完美,谢谢!